Kenneth Joseph Bartha
Born on August 7, 1928 to the parents of Joseph and Rose Bartha, first son of four boys. Lived in the Riverside section of Buffalo, New York. Attended Public school 60 and graduated from McKinley Vocational High School in 1947. Enlisted in the U.S. Navy and served on the ship USS Mindoro CVE-120 and honorably discharged in 1950. Enlisted in the U.S. Army in 1950 and was stationed with the 382nd Military Police Battalion in Mannheim, Germany. Married Renate Becker in Mannheim, Germany. Honorably discharged from the Army in 1953. Worked at Strippit Inc. as a tool and die designer, product supervisor, manufacturing engineer and plant engineer. Retired in June, 1991 after 36 years. Beloved husband of the late Renate (nee Becker) Bartha; devoted father of Heidi (Ray) Kirschner, Karin Snyder and the late Kurt Bartha; cherished grandfather of Melanie Kirschner, Donovan (Tana) Snyder, Ray Kirschner III, Sandi (Robert) Madigan and Joseph Bartha; adored great-grandfather of Bennett, Timothy, Patrick, Evelyn and Aiden.
